注:该文章所提到的操作可能对操作系统存在影响,为了确保系统正常和避免可能的数据丢失,请您务必在操作前创建系统盘、数据盘的快照。
ECS win 2008 R2系统打开网站图片不能正常显示,具体情况如下:
部分图片能够正常显示,部分显示为灰色的点阵。
同时在PC端使用浏览器打开对应的链接,图片显示是正常的。
这个通常是windows server 2008 R2系统中的IE 11浏览器和网站代码不兼容。因为Web程序会去调用IE 获取网页上面的图片,如果IE中显示的图片异常,那么获取到图片就是异常,鉴于此种情况,需要解决IE 浏览器兼容性问题。
解决方法
此时,可以在打开浏浏览器,进入“开发者模式”:
尝试使用兼容模式打开网页,如使用IE 10模式打开网页测试看能否正常打开:
如果IE 10或者IE 8等兼容模式是可以打开网页,那么说明是IE 11模式和用户网页不兼容。
此时,可以先对系统盘创建快照,然后卸载服务器端的IE 11浏览器,那么就回退到了IE 10浏览器,可以再次尝试打开网页。
卸载IE 11的方法
卸载完成后,重启服务器,系统中的IE 版本就自动降级为IE 10。如果IE 10仍然不能使用,可以参照上面的方法卸载,直到IE版本降级为IE 8。 IE 8的网页兼容性比较广。
IE 版本降级到10后,再此访问网页,页面图片可以正常加载:
然后通过程序调用IE获取图片,获取到的图片是正常,至此问题解决。
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。